How long do Pistons take to retract?

A piston normally takes 1.5 redstone ticks (3 game ticks) to extend or retract. However, if a piston is deactivated before it completes its extension, it will instantly “abort” — it will immediately “drop” any blocks it is pushing at their pushed location and instantly retract back to a closed state.

When do sticky Pistons retract in Minecraft Java?

Sticky pistons stick to a block only when retracting, so a block next to the piston head can be pushed aside by another piston and sticky pistons cannot hold falling blocks horizontally against gravity. In Java Edition, pistons finish extending early and start retracting if given a pulse shorter than 3 game ticks (1.5 redstone ticks; 0.15 seconds).

What kind of blocks can not be pushed by Pistons in Minecraft?

In beta 1.7.1, there was a block duplicating glitch using pistons and sticky pistons. Some blocks cannot be pushed by pistons and the piston head will not extend. These blocks include: Obsidian, Bedrock, Furnaces, Chests, etc. Pistons will not push blocks into the Void or the top of the map.

How to put sticky Pistons on a delay?

It consists of 2 hoppers, pointed at each other. You send a signal into a piston which pushes the redstone block to the other hopper. This causes items to begin to transfer into that hopper. A comparator reads that hopper and when it fills enough, the redstone block is pressed back to it’s original location.
